What Is Celigo?

Celigo is an Integration Platform as a Service (iPaaS)—a cloud-based platform that allows businesses to connect applications, automate workflows, and manage data movement across systems without writing custom code for every connection.

In simple terms: Celigo helps one system talk to another system automatically.

At its core, Celigo offers:

  • Pre-built connectors for popular applications like NetSuite, Salesforce, Shopify, Workday, and more.
  • Integration templates and “flows” to easily configure data syncs.
  • A visual interface for designing and managing integrations.
  • Advanced customization options for developers when needed.
  • Monitoring and error handling tools to ensure everything runs smoothly.

Celigo strikes the perfect balance: it’s easy enough for non-technical users to build integrations, yet powerful enough for IT teams and developers to customize complex workflows.

The 6 Main Parts of the Celigo Platform

Home:

A simple overview of all the integration flows you’ve started or completed. It shows whether a flow is active, successful, or if it recently failed.

Dashboard:

This is where you can see:

  • Exact run times of flows
  • Status of each run (in progress, completed, failed)
  • Errors and timestamps
  • Filters to quickly find the flow you’re looking for

The Dashboard provides real-time visibility and control over integration performance.

Tools:

There are multiple parts of Tools tab. There is the flow builder, this is where you would actually build the flow. You would choose a source and a destination application. If the flow would be as simple as you want to take a google document and move it into a google drive you would connect the google document as the source and the destination would be the add destination (this is a simple example). You would select the source -> create connection -> select what to export -> preview data -> save.

Then in the destination one the steps are as followed.
Select a source ->  Select what you want the input to do in this destination -> create the connection -> give it what data you are inputting and then preview the data.

This is how you would create a simple flow in Celigo that would take a google document and put it into google drive.

There is another tab inside the Tools tab and it is called Data Loader. This page is as it sounds it would load the data from a source into a destination. There are thousands or different applications that you can connect to which makes this super user friendly.

The two other tabs are Reports and Playground. Reports is used if there are any reports that you want to create based on your flows you can see statistics about the flows and you can build exactly what you would want to see in the reports tab and then the playground gives you a space to play around and test Celigo products to see what is best to integrate with what sources.
